Out-of-town Bridesmaids
I have three bridesmaids that will not be in NY to shop for their dresses. Do I get their measurements and bring them to the store with me so the dresses can be ordered? Two out of three will come for fittings, but one may not be able to. Can I get the dress from the store when it comes in and mail it to her so she can have it altered? How has everyone handled this.

Out-of-town Bridesmaids
I planned my wedding from NC and three of my bridesmaids live in NY, one in NC, one in FL, one in PA, and one in VA. I ordered the dresses from a shop in NC. Just got all of their measurements picked the closest to their measurements for a size (on the size chart). Then I picked up the dresses- shipped them off to each bridesmaid and they had them altered if they needed to on their own. Many shops will not ship the dresses -- and do not include alterations. This seemed easiest for everyone.

Be careful about ordering from different shops
I have a similar situation. 2 of my BMs live in Mass, but are coming here for measurements. First, make sure a professional takes the measurements. A lot of girls measure their hips in the wrong place and that can greatly affect the size of the dress that is needed. Also, if you order from a different shop you might get a dress made from a different dye lot. The colors will be close but not exact. Just something to consider.
